Fashionista Editors Reveal Their Athleisure Must-Haves for January

From a sweat-wicking headband to a candy-colored sweatsuit.

If you've ever had the pleasure of visiting the Fashionista office, then you know it's packed with pictures of Bella Hadid and, on most days, editors in spandex. We love a Fashion (capital F) moment more than most, but we also love comfort: "It's an athleisure day for me" is a Slack statement that's typed no less than twice a week.

When it comes to casual dress, many of us turn to Entireworld for a candy-colored sweatsuit or Girlfriend Collective for leggings that are a stretchy alternative to traditionally stiff denim. This isn't to say we never dress up, because we do, but some days we deserve to treat ourselves to softly constructed clothing, whether we have a Barre class after work or not.

So to kick the new year off, we've rounded up our favorite athleisure purchases, from a sweat-wicking headband to sneakers that are made for running (or walking to brunch). In addition to workout-friendly garments, we've also thrown in some must-have gym accessories, like a yoga mat that'll make you want to Shavasana for hours.
